Student opportunities and activities
At Paddington Public School, we offer a variety of programs in the classroom and across the school to help students build new skills, make friends and explore new interests.
Our programs include:
- School sport, athletics and inter-school competitions
- Creative and performing arts groups and showcases
- Cultural and language activities
- Excursions and incursions
- Public speaking and debating
- Lunchtime and interest-based clubs
- Student leadership opportunities
- Activities that support high potential and gifted learners.

Student Voice and Leadership
Our school leadership team, along with the Student Representative Council (SRC), gives students a strong voice in our school community. These opportunities help students develop leadership skills and a sense of responsibility by sharing ideas, planning events, and supporting initiatives that enhance our school environment. The leadership team takes an active role in running assemblies and leading projects, while the SRC has led initiatives such as the beautification of bathrooms in response to student feedback.

Lunch Clubs
Students can participate in a range of lunchtime clubs offered throughout the year, tailored to their interests. Options include Lego, Art, Choir, Hip Hop, Dance, Drama, News Club and Chess. These clubs offer enjoyable and engaging chances for students to learn new skills, express their creativity and build connections with peers.
News Club
The Paddington News Club gives students a voice. Each week, students in Years 3-6 get together to write news stories, share school highlights and record podcasts about things they care about, such as their hobbies, school events and community interests.
Illuminate
Illuminate Paddo is a bi-annual event where students collaboratively blend ICT, literacy, music, drama, animation, and creative arts with science and geography themes to create unique animations. These animations, developed through hands-on exploration of animation techniques, are proudly showcased to the school community and the broader public during a special evening celebration.
